Take the Tube to work? I'll catch a wave instead
Evening Standard
'A surfer has ditched crowded Tubes and buses and started commuting to work by board.
Andy White decided to make the twohour paddle (there are no waves of course) along the Thames from his home in Putney to Moorgate every morning to keep fit.
Mr White, originally from Newquay, is now backing a scheme to encourage more office workers to use London's outdoor spaces during their working day.
The 32-year-old started commuting on a 14ft surfboard three months ago when he moved to the capital.
He sets off from Putney pier at 5.30am, paddles five miles to Vauxhall Bridge...'
